Description

(R*,S*)-8,9-Dibromo-5,5,12,12-Tetrabutyl-7,10-Dioxo-6,11-Dioxa-5,12-Distannahexadecane is a high-purity organotin compound featuring a unique dibrominated, distannoxane core structure. This compound matters as a versatile and highly reactive intermediate for advanced organic synthesis and materials science research. It is primarily needed by R&D chemists and process engineers in the pharmaceutical, agrochemical, and specialty polymer industries for developing novel catalysts and functional materials.

Basic Information

Product Name (R*,S*)-8,9-Dibromo-5,5,12,12-Tetrabutyl-7,10-Dioxo-6,11-Dioxa-5,12-Distannahexadecane
CAS No. 31732-71-5
Molecular Formula C24H48Br2O4Sn2
Molecular Weight 862.86 g/mol
Synonyms 8,9-Dibromo-5,5,12,12-tetrabutyl-7,10-dioxo-6,11-dioxa-5,12-distannahexadecane; Dibromodibutyltin Oxide Dimer; 1,3-Dibromo-1,1,3,3-tetrabutyl-2,4-dioxa-1,3-distannacyclobutane; Tetrabutyldibromodistannoxane; Organotin Bromide Dimer; Stannoxane Dimer, dibrominated; (Dibromodibutylstannylene)oxide Dimer

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ation. Keep away from incompatible materials such as strong acids, bases, and oxidizing agents.
